The present disclosure describes a first device sending to a second device a face template of the user of the first device. When the second device captures an image, the second device may compare the face template to a second face template derived from the captured image. If a match is determined to exist, the second device may send the captured image to the first device. The face template may be transferred over a first communication interface, while the captured image may be sent over a second communication interface. The first communication interface may be Bluetooth and the second communication interface may be WIFI Direct. As such, the system may function in environments without cellular coverage and/or infrastructure WIFI networks. Additionally, the user of the first device does not need to be identified, only matched to the second face template.

Venue operated camera system for automated capture of images
Methods, devices, computer readable medium, and systems are described for capturing images at venues. Venues are organized around one or more shotspots. Shotspots are geographic locations which may have one or more subspots and one or more venue operated camera devices. Subspots identify positions to be occupied by subjects within a shotspot. Shotspots are installed, registered, and operated by venue operators. Images are captured based on triggers which may include one or more conditions under which images will be stored. Conditions may also include negative limitations. Users wishing to use a shotspot do so through a mobile device. Interacting through the mobile device, a user may discover, receive directions to, navigate to, and arrange sessions during which they may use a shotspot. Users may also receive sample images, define triggers, initiate triggers, preview framing, and receive images through the mobile application.

Multi zone, multi dwelling, multi user climate systems
An architecture is presented for one or more climate systems controlled by one or more thermostat devices located in one or more dwellings associated with one or more users. Depending on the combination of the above factors, ecorank information is determined and presented. In some cases, the thermostats operate independently and settings are not propagated. In other cases, the thermostats operate dependently and settings are mirrored. One thermostat may be used to control another. Setting changes in at one thermostat may be presented at another thermostat. In some cases, the setting changes may require confirmation. In some instances, a hub device may be used to interconnect a thermostat device and server device.

Method and system for determining comparative usage information at a server device
Methods, devices, and computer readable medium are described for receiving from a thermostat device at a server device climate system usage information and settings and sending from the server device ecorank information, wherein the ecorank information is derived from a comparison of usage of climate systems controlled by the thermostat device in comparison to a comparison group, the comparison group comprising other climate systems controlled by other thermostat devices. The comparison group is determined based on profile information describing the dwelling, dwelling size, dwelling location, dwelling occupants, climate system technology, and related information. In some embodiments, the ecorank information may be one or more of a numerical score, percentage, graphic, icon, color, letter, and an audio item. In some embodiments, the energy consumed by the climate systems may be reported by an associated energy measurement device or estimated by heating and cooling usage hours.

In the present disclosure, methods, systems, and non-transitory computer readable medium are described whereby images are obtained at a server or another suitable computing device. The images may contain metadata indicating the time, date, and geographic location of capture. In one aspect of the present disclosure, this metadata may be used to determine that the images were captured at an event that is still occurring (in-process event). Users who have uploaded images that are captured at the event may be invited to join an image sharing pool. In response to accepting the invitation, the images provided by the user may be contributed to the image sharing pool, and other users having also joined the image sharing pool will be able to access the newly contributed images. The event associated with the sharing pool may be detected by the system or proposed by a moderator.

A system and method for optimizing the uploading of digital assets from a client node to a central node in a digital asset sharing system are provided. Digital assets residing at a client node are each tagged with one or more keywords. The client node sends a list of the keywords used to tag the digital assets to the central node and requests that invitations including the list of keywords be sent to potential guests. The potential guests select one or more of the keywords and send responses to the central node identifying the selected keywords. The central node processes the responses to generate a list of desired keywords and requests the digital images tagged with one or more keywords from the list of desired keywords from the client node. In response, the client node uploads the requested digital assets to the central node where they are stored.
